Why is Cyberpunk obsessed with Japan?

When Cyberpunk appeared in the 80s, and to some extent the 70s, Japan was seen as a country in ascendancy. They were on the cutting-edge of consumer technology, Japanese style was finding it's way into the popular culture, and financially Japanese business was the envy of the world.

Why is Japan so important in cyberpunk?

Japan's origins in cyberpunk

Asian symbolism is often used to highlight the future of technology and presented in dystopian settings. At the heart of it all is Japan, a country that was seen as a technological powerhouse at the same time the cyberpunk genre was developing in the 1980s.

What is the oldest cyberpunk anime?

Anime and manga. The Japanese cyberpunk subgenre began in 1982 with the debut of Katsuhiro Otomo's manga series Akira, with its 1988 anime film adaptation, which Otomo directed, later popularizing the subgenre.

Why is Night City called Night City?

However, on September 20, 1998, approximately four years after the construction of the city began, Richard Night was shot and killed in his penthouse suite. His killer was never found. In honor of Richard Night, the city was officially renamed Night City.
